My name is Avelonia Brown and I want to tell my story. I’m 32 years old and I’m just getting out of an abusive relationship. I don’t want or need your sympathy. All I need is for you to listen and hopefully learn.

Me when I was a kid...


A crime scene photo of my mother... my grandmother stole it from the station.


    I’ve always had it hard. I remember when I was 6, my mother was strangled by a John and I was sent to live with my grandmother. My grandmother always resented me. I am an only child and I’m half Japanese and half black. My grandmother was a miserable old lady and she took it out on me. She called me every name you can think of. Once, I went to take the garbage out to the dumpster and she claimed to have looked all over for me. Needless to say I got in trouble. She made me stand in the kitchen doorway with my back turned while she heated up the oven. Next thing I know a hot hanger was being pressed against my forearm. She grabbed my hair and told me, “you better not move or you’ll get something worse.” I closed my eyes and tried to hold back the tears. When I couldn’t take it anymore I let out a loud scream. She didn’t like that at all! She took the hanger away from my arm and slammed me up against the wall.
    I still have the scar on the back of my head.



After too many unfortunate events, I was put into foster care. I had to go to school with a black eye one day and that was the end of that part of my life.



When I turned,  16 I ran away from the group home I was in. Every foster family that I had had given me back for one reason or another. So, from 9-16, I lived in a group home. I didn’t know what I was going to do when I left but I had to leave. I left the lovely, Glenmont Group Home in the middle of the night on my 16th birthday. I climbed out of the window and as soon as I did, the cold February air burned my skin. I didn’t own a coat so I began to wonder if I should do it or not. My mind wandered back to when I was 9 years old….


    I had just gotten back from my last foster family when a tall white man approached me. He knelt down and took my plastic bag of clothes. He touched my shoulder and said, “everything will be alright.” He had a kindness in his eyes that I’ve never seen. At that moment, I felt that I could trust him and I smiled for the first time in many years.



Later that night, I was in my bunk bed when I felt heavy breathing on my face. It was the tall white man again. I cannot recall his name and that’s probably for the best. He gently touched my forehead and told me to come with him.



I got up and followed him into a dark room on the third floor. When my eyes finally adjusted, I noticed that we were in the game room. Before I could say anything he covered my mouth and threw me on the filthy couch….



    Tears rolled down my face. Before I knew it, I was out of the window and walking in the snow.  I couldn’t think about that now. I was on my way to a new life.

Part II

I had never been outside the group home walls alone so I had no idea where I was going. I walked for what seemed like hours in the freezing cold, with nothing but the clothes on  my back. I couldn’t bear another second out here. Finally, I came upon a small bar and went in for warmth. I sat at the counter and asked if they had coffee. I didn’t really drink coffee, but I thought it would warm me up. The bartender looked at me confused and asked, “are you alright hun?” I just shivered and looked down. She walked away and I could see her out of the corner of my eye talking to a guy in a suit and looking back at me. I started to get up and leave when the man came over to me. He looked at me just as the waitress had. He said, “how old are you?” I told him I was 23 because I didn’t want him to ask me anything else. I don’t think he believed me but he gave me a coat and a number to a homeless shelter. He offered me a free meal and I gladly accepted. I ate my rice and chicken and left without a sound.



    I looked around and saw that I was on 15th Street. I hugged myself to absorb my new found warmth. I needed a place to stay but I didn’t want to stay in a homeless shelter. How could that be any better? Finally, I came across an abandoned building and there were bums sleeping everywhere around a fire. I walked over and took a seat next to one of them. I placed my hands over the fire and absorbed the good heat. I got up from the fire and walked to a dirty mattress. I dragged it close to the fire and slept.



    I was awaken about 5 hours later by a violent cold breeze against my feet. Someone had stolen my sneakers. I cried until I had no more tears. I had completely lost track of time and I huddled under my coat waiting for people to come to start the fire. It started getting dark and no one came.



        I planted my feet in the cold wet snow and decided to walk to the nearest shelter I could find. Preferably, a place with heat. I walked about 5 blocks before I came to a gorgeous house. I wondered, why couldn’t that be me? I walked slowly to the window and peered inside. There was a family of 4 sitting around a fireplace watching a movie. I don’t remember what the movie was. I wondered if I should sneak through the window or just knock. I caught a glimpse of myself in the window and realized that I had snot frozen to my mouth and nose. At some point, my mouth had started bleeding. My lip had been swollen from the last beating I had gotten in the group home. At that point, I decided to knock.





    A tall black woman answered the door. I asked her if I could come inside and shower and sleep. She looked at me as if I had lost my mind. At first I thought she couldn’t understand me, after all, I did speak broken English. I didn’t get very far in school. I dropped out in the 8th grade and never looked back. I said, “ain’t you gonna let me in?” She called John to the door. He must have been her husband. John gave me one look and told his wife to get away from the door. I couldn’t believe they were just going to leave me out here with no shoes and this stuff on my face. The door slammed before I had a chance to beg.



    My feet were completely numb and started turning purple. I started down the steps of the porch and passed out from the severe cold.
